vuthaiha90 > 27-06-20, 06:59 PM
tranthanhan1962 > 28-06-20, 10:39 AM
vuthaiha90 > 28-06-20, 09:31 PM
(28-06-20, 10:39 AM)tranthanhan1962 Đã viết: Đê xủ lý viec này, người ta không copy pats đâu. Dùng mail merge mới nhanhVâng ạ, Doc.FormField của em làm như kiểu mail merge mà, nhưng khi ra đến kết quả cuối cùng thì em muốn loại bỏ những cái formfield đó đi trở thành text thường để edit cho dễ dàng. Vì 1 số trường hợp thì cần edit đoạn giữa lại 1 tý. dùng lệnh if thì cũng khá nhiều trường hợp, và có thể mình chưa nghĩ ra được hết trường hợp mà nêu if ra
vuthaiha90 > 28-06-20, 11:51 PM
Sub FormFieldsRemoval()
Dim objFld As FormField
Dim intCount, intLoop As Integer
For Each objFld In ActiveDocument.FormFields
intCount = intCount + 1
Next
For intLoop = 1 To intCount
ActiveDocument.FormFields(intLoop).Select
With Selection
.Copy
.PasteAndFormat (wdFormatPlainText)
End With
Next intLoop
End Sub
Xuân Thanh > 29-06-20, 10:56 AM